Output 966953096cd0df33b96a65fa13a5fe63ea6c79202e334a3645abc6fe81344c84:22

value
179944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bdda7151aa1b9492a7a8140335966e3d8687392 OP_EQUAL
address
32mktMKMDCzdCAcsHgmTBEZ521qQ5Skzos
transaction
966953096cd0df33b96a65fa13a5fe63ea6c79202e334a3645abc6fe81344c84
spent
true